# Building Access — Holiday Opening Hours (Brindlehart House)

During the Midwinter closure (24 Dec–2 Jan), the main lobby is locked around the clock and the concierge desk is unstaffed. Night-shift colleagues on the Osprey rota must enter via the east stairwell only; the lifts run in restricted mode after 22:00. Log every entry in the foyer ledger so Facilities can reconcile against the alarm system. The stairwell keypad accepts the seasonal staff code noted below.

turnstile pass: bdg-QZV-3

Welcome to the Ladlewise plugin program. Your plugin receives scaled ingredient quantities from the core calculator after unit normalization, so never rescale values yourself. Always declare supported unit systems in your manifest, and handle fractional yields gracefully. Review the conversion-table spec carefully before publishing. For manifest validation questions or sandbox access, contact the plugin team at the address below.

alerts address for fafop-tajog: keleth.joreth.fravan@qorvelhq.corp

## Canteen Link Door — Level 2

The Fenwick Row canteen connects to the offices of Tarnbrook Analytics next door via the level-2 link corridor. Assistants booking shared lunches should note the link door locks automatically at 14:30 daily. Tarnbrook staff may enter our side only when escorted; our staff may cross freely during service hours. Keep the fire door between kitchens closed at all times. To release the link door from our side, enter the code below.

turnstile pass: bdg-JVSWH-52711

☐ ORM refactor gate (Brindlewick data layer): before tagging the release, confirm the legacy Querrel ORM shims are fully behind the compatibility flag and the new repository classes pass the parity suite against a production snapshot. Any schema drift found during parity runs blocks the tag — no exceptions, we learned that in the v4 rollback. Record the candidate build that cleared parity directly below this item.

pipeline stamp: htk9_ce63042d9